1. Video Gets Attention and Drives Engagement
In a world full of text and photos, video stands out. Social media algorithms on platforms like Instagram and Facebook prioritize video content, especially short-form videos like Reels and Shorts. This means a video has a much better chance of showing up in a person’s feed than a photo or a text post.
Holding onto Attention
Canadians spend a lot of time watching videos. They’re watching everything from quick tutorials to long-form documentaries on platforms like YouTube. Video Content in Canadian Marketing is more engaging than any other type of content because it combines visuals, sound, and a story. People are more likely to stop scrolling for a video, and they’re also more likely to watch it to the end. In fact, video posts on Instagram can get over 20% more engagement than photos. This high engagement tells the social media algorithms that your content is valuable, and they show it to even more people.
Building a Human Connection
Video Content in Canadian Marketing is the best way to show the human side of your brand. You can use it to introduce your team, share your brand’s story, or show a behind-the-scenes look at how you make your products. A video can show emotion and personality in a way that text can’t. This builds trust with your audience, which is a huge part of turning a follower into a customer. A Canadian business that shows its passion for its product or a genuine love for its community will build a strong, loyal following through video.
2. Video Influences Buying Decisions
Video doesn’t just entertain; it sells. Canadian consumers often watch Video Content in Canadian Marketing before they make a purchase. They look for product demonstrations, reviews, and explainer videos to help them understand a product better.
Explaining Your Product Clearly
You might sell a complicated product or service. A quick, one-minute video can explain it better than a long page of text. A Video Content in Canadian Marketing can show your product in action, highlight its key features, and show how it solves a problem for your customers. Over 90% of consumers say an explainer video helped them learn more about a product, and a huge percentage say that watching a video has convinced them to buy something.
Building Trust with Testimonials
Customer testimonial Video Content in Canadian Marketing are extremely powerful. A video of a real Canadian customer talking about how your product helped them is far more trustworthy than a written review. People trust other people, and when they see a video of a satisfied customer, they are more likely to believe what you are selling. You can create a simple, unpolished video of a customer sharing their experience, and it will feel authentic and genuine.
3. Video Helps Your SEO and Website Traffic
Video Content in Canadian Marketing isn’t just for social media; it can also help you get found on Google. Videos, especially on platforms like YouTube, are a huge part of how people search for information. YouTube is the second-largest search engine in the world, right after Google.
Ranking Higher in Search
When you add a Video Content in Canadian Marketing to a blog post on your website, people stay on the page longer to watch it. This tells search engines like Google that your content is valuable and that people like it. Google often rewards content with higher search rankings if it has a video. You should also optimize your videos with a strong title, a good description, and relevant keywords to help people find them.
Driving Traffic from YouTube
Many Canadians use YouTube as a search engine. They look for “how to fix a leaky faucet,” “best hiking trails in Alberta,” or “review of new Canadian car.” If you create Video Content in Canadian Marketing that answer these questions, you can drive a ton of new traffic to your website. You can add a link to your website in the video description and mention it in the video itself. This is a powerful way to bring a new audience to your business.
The bottom line is that video content is essential for any Canadian marketing strategy. It helps you get noticed, build trust, and drive sales. You don’t need a professional studio or a massive budget. A good smartphone, some natural light, and a clear idea are all you need to get started.
